Job Responsibilities

A. Scope of services

 IT officer’s job will be contractual. Responsible to setup an upgraded and coordinated networking system among IEDCR, meteorology department and other sentinel sites, setup EWARS dashboard and DHIS2 software interface for regular reporting to provide climate sensitive disease-specific information, coordination of training for concerned personnel including doctors, nurses and lab technicians, analyze project data & reporting. His Terms of References are following:

  1. Responsible to setup an upgraded and coordinated networking system among IEDCR, metrology offices and specified sentinel sites
  2. Prepare an EWARS dashboard, required apps to be linked with DHIS2 software and other reporting system
  3. Establish a network of data sharing among IEDCR, metrology offices and other sentinel site laboratories.
  4. Setup EWARS dashboard and DHIS2 interface for regular reporting to provide specified climate sensitive disease surveillances   information that is requested as part of the reporting requirements of the network.
  5. Develop or incorporate software or apps as per requirement to support early warning system
  6.  Coordinate and arrange for training for concerned personnel including doctors, nurses and lab technicians
  7. Analyze reports from all sentinel sites
  8. Support to define climate sensitive disease thresholds that could trigger early warnings for potential outbreaks within the EWARS framework
  9. Technical support to implement and maintenance of risk prediction tools from WHO
  10. Give technical support for trouble shooting for IEDCR surveillance related activities
  11. As needed s/he will visit to surveillance sites for any trouble shooting.
  12. Regular epidemiology and laboratory data compilation
  13. Regular climate sensitive disease (dengue, rota-virus & cholera/diarrhea etc) surveillance data compilation, analysis and reporting
  14. Synchronization of both epidemiological and laboratory data at EWARS dashboard and DHIS2 or at any specified software/apps
  15. Uploading to the IEDCR website
  16. Support for preparing and uploading any epidemiological bulletin
  17. Support to IEDCR IT department
  18. Report preparation on activities, lessons learned, challenges, and recommendations for future action
  19. To perform other duties or tasks assigned by Director IEDCR
